Whatcom Falls Park is a 241-acre park with four sets of waterfalls and miles of hiking trails. It is a great place for a picnic, a hike, or a bike ride. There are also several playgrounds, picnic shelters, and a fishing pond.

The SPARK Museum of Electrical Invention is a museum dedicated to the history of electricity and electrical engineering. It features interactive exhibits, live demonstrations, and a collection of rare artifacts and documents.
